In the latest update in the changes it states "You can now use data tags in the email subjects to get information from the order/user." I can not find how to do this. Where can I find the data tags to be used? Do I need to put them in the language file? If so, what data tag can I use for the order amount? In the language file %s is constantly used. How does Hikashop know what to replace this with?

Hi,

In the translation text of the subject of the email, you can use such tag: {order_full_price} and it will be replaced automatically.

ORDER_ADMIN_NOTIFICATION_SUBJECT="%s bestelling ontvangen {order_full_price}"

That is what my language file now says, but that doesn't do anything. It still only gives the first part (order number and text "bestelling ontvangen").

The translation is only in this language file. So what am I doing wrong?

Hi,

Then maybe you have an old build of the latest version. Download again the install package and install it on your website. It will have a patch for the tags to work properly in email subjects.
